staging: comedi: adv_pci1710: only calc the pacer divisors once



When the cmd->convert_src == TRIG_TIMER the divisors needed to
generate the pacer time are calculated in the (*do_cmdtest) to
validate the cmd->convert_arg. The core always does the (*do_cmdtest)
before the (*do_cmd) so there is no reason to recalc the divisors.

Save the calculated divisors in the private data as 'next_divisor[12]'.
The (*do_cmd) then transfers them to the private data 'divisor[12]' so
that they can be used to set the timer for the command immediately or
later when the cmd->start_src is TRIG_EXT (mode 2 in this driver).
